NISSAN LEAF G 2017-
Car manufacturer website
Ev is a pioneer. The battery is 40kWh and 62kWh. The distance that can actually run at 40kWh is about 250km. The running is moist and pleasant, but the interior is a little cheap.
















Mercedes-Benz EQC 400 4MATIC 2018-
Car manufacturer website
The first EV in Mercedes-Benz. The battery capacity is 80kWh, the range is 450km, but it actually has a smaller range, so EQC is likely to be weak on long-distance driving.
